Samuel Goldsmith was born in 1760 in Stafford, Stafford, Virginia, United States, the child of John Richard Goldsmith And Martha Powell. In 1792, Samuel Goldsmith resided in Nelson County, KY. In 1810, Samuel Goldsmith resided in Elizabethtown, Hardin, Kentucky, United States. Samuel Goldsmith married Elizabeth Case, and had children including Jesse Goldsmith. Samuel Goldsmith passed away in 1827 in Hardin, Kentucky, United States.
